#8f1958 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#8f1958 is composed of 56.1% red, 9.8%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 82.5% magenta, 38.5% yellow and 43.9% black. It has a hue angle of 328 degrees, a saturation of 70.2% and a lightness of 32.9%. #8f1958 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ff32b0 with #1f0000. Closest websafe color is: #990066.

#8f1958 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#8f1958 has RGB values of R:143, G:25,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.83, Y:0.38, K:0.44. Its decimal value is 9378136.

Shades and Tints of #8f1958
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090206 is the darkest color, while #fef8f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#8f1958
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#555354 is the less saturated color, while #a20659 is the most saturated one.
